A portable greenhouse

Posted by butterflymomok 7 (My Page) on
Wed, Nov 18, 09 at 13:09

For those of you who, like me, have been wanting a greenhouse, I found portable ones that are very reasonable in price. I purchased one and my husband and I put it up in less than an hour. I now have a place to overwinter those plants that can't make it through our winters.

My husband, who had been adamantly opposed to a greenhouse, approved of this one, cause it can be taken down and stored in the summer. I've included a link to the website where I made my purchase. These are listed other places for much more.

RE: A portable greenhouse

  • Posted by brandon7 6b (like 7b now) TN (My Page) on
    Wed, Nov 18, 09 at 16:55

I sure wish you luck. I had one somewhat similar to that and it started seriously degrading/falling apart in less than a year. I was kind of shocked that it didn't last longer because it looked somewhat tough when I put it up. From the feedback I've seen on most of these mini greenhouses, I think the majority of them aren't worth the money.
